I personally think Carpenter had the best idea, make a different story for other halloweens. But if Carpenter could have only come up with a better story than the shit that was the third, it could have succeeded, he should have just directed himself, it was so poorly executed. Instead, although 2 wasnt as good, it was a good sequel, and ended the series nicely, we were stuck with a remake of sorts with 4, which was ok, 5, which I dont know what the hell they were thinking, 7 was big because Scream was big, and 8 was just what the french call a certain, I dont know what.
The only real film that ever showed balls for the franchise was 6. Granted it was portrayed horribly, and Donald Pleasance was really bed ridden in the role, sad to see. The mythos of michael Myers was very interesting, being a part of a druid curse. But it was screwed.
Like they say though. By reimaging, i wouldn't be suprised, if they spend this entire film as a build up for a 2 parter, setting him up, with the murder. Then horrible mistreatments, and possible unexplained occurances in the mental asylum, Then of course, he escapes right at the end. I would think the psychological aspects of the mental asylum could be very chilling. Carpenter even said that seeing a boy in a mental hosptial was the most chilling thing he's ever seen, too bad he was too structured on the main story to expore it.
*So in closing, I'm all for the reimaging because, lets face it Continuity failed after the 2nd film. There was a middle trilogy of sorts, a film that pretended the previous 4 didnt happen, and the 8th, well, completely did for Michael Myers what Anderson did for the Predator.
